What are the key considerations for selecting a trash can in a high-altitude environment?
Selecting the right trash can for high-altitude environments requires careful consideration of several factors to ensure functionality and longevity. Here are the key aspects to evaluate:
1. Material Durability: Opt for corrosion-resistant materials like stainless steel or heavy-duty plastic to withstand extreme temperature fluctuations and UV exposure.
2. Weight and Portability: Lightweight yet sturdy designs are ideal for easy transport and installation in remote or rugged areas.
3. Weather Resistance: Choose trash cans with airtight lids and robust seals to prevent wind dispersal and protect against snow or rain.
4. Capacity and Design: Larger capacities reduce frequent emptying, while ergonomic designs ensure ease of use in challenging terrains.
5. Environmental Impact: Prioritize eco-friendly options, such as bins with recycling compartments, to align with sustainable waste management practices.
By focusing on these factors, you can select a trash can that performs reliably in high-altitude conditions while minimizing maintenance and environmental harm.
